I have been designing and building secure cloud architectures, Kubernetes platforms, and CI/CD pipelines for over 8 years. I have achieved significant improvements in system resiliency for EU-regulated FinTechs and SaaS platforms, including 99.99% uptime, 40% faster deployment frequencies, and major reductions in cloud spend. I am looking for remote B2B contracts where I can help engineering teams scale their infrastructure reliably. What sets me apart is my deep focus on GitOps and DevSecOps: I don't just provision infrastructure; I embed policy-as-code (Kyverno/OPA), dynamic secrets (Vault), and strict security controls directly into the developer workflow from day one.
